- Violet Laack, age 97, of Chilton, died on Tuesday, January 28, 2014 at Century Ridge in Chilton. She was born June 2, 1916 in Maple Grove, daughter of the late Ben & Clara (Cavanaugh) Kings.
Vi married Ruben L. Laack on August 16, 1945 in Maple Grove, WI. The couple worked sided by side operating Laacks Cheese Factory until 1987 when the factory was sold to Dan Ratajczak, Sr.
During this time, Vi also had the pleasure of teaching children for 49 years. She began teaching in rural schools grades 1 through 8, but a majority of her teaching career was in the Kiel Public School District. Following her retirement from full time teaching, she continued to be a substitute teacher for another 10 years.
She was a member of Good Shepherd Catholic Church, the Brillion Woman's Club, the Retired Teachers Association, the Senior Citizens organization in Chilton where she served as Secretary, and was proud to be in the Red Hat Society.
Survivors include numerous nieces, nephews, other relatives and friends.
She was preceded in death by her parents: Ben & Clara Kings; a brother: Robert Kings; and a sister: Phyllis Schmelter.
